Resumo: The political, economic and social scenario has given rise to questioning on the part of citizens regarding their own space for political participation. The social movement in the form of protest is an example of this growing need for society’s participation. One of the features that can expand these possibilities is technology. It is correct to affirm that the advancement and popularization of technology, more specifically, of social networks, establish new opportunities to expand these virtual spaces. In line with this scenario, there are several initiatives whose objective is to develop tools that facilitate or promote citizen participation. On the other hand, there are still many issues that need to be investigated in order for the use of these tools to be effective. The objective of this work is to propose a tool that facilitates the discussion of problems of society by citizens. In the analysis of the results, obtained through an experiment with users to evaluate the effectiveness of the tool, it was possible to perceive that although the majority of users agree that the discussion model and the proposed problem register can contribute to the real solution of the same, there is still a lack of motivation and engagement of citizens that needs to be studied and improved
